🔍I. Why do extreme production environments have to use modular line bodies?
Just look at the new energy battery factory - the humidity in the cell assembly workshop must be pressed toBelow 1% RH(equivalent to 1/10 of the humidity of desert air), otherwise the electrode material becomes waste in seconds; and the medical chip workshop is even more ruthless, with no more than 35,200 0.5 micron particles per cubic metre (ISO6 standard), which is ten times cleaner than the operating theatre.
Conventional conveyor lines go straight to the ground here:
- Metal Roller Chain Rust: Dry room 1% RH environment, ordinary bearings rusted to death in a week
- Lubricant contaminationISO6 workshop strictly prohibits the volatilisation of oil and grease, ordinary chain lubricant will scrap the whole batch of products in minutes.
- Catastrophe modification: Want to expand production? Sorry, please stop production for three months and tear down the walls.
And the modular design of Rexroth line bodies, such as the TS2-PV series, gives you three big kills straight away:
- Parts are fully compatible: 90% parts are common to standard TS2, no need to wait for imported spare parts for maintenance.
- Plug and Play Environment Kit: ISO6 clean kit, anti-static belt, stainless steel bearings, as easy as changing a mobile phone case
- Zero waste of spaceMinimum 80x80mm tray fits into lab corners, supports up to 3 metre wide battery packs.

🏜️III.1% RH Dry Environment Survival Guide: Anti-static is a Life Saver
The scariest thing about the drying room is actuallyelectrostatic discharge-Humidity 1% when the human body static voltage can rush to 15kV, enough to break through the circuit board! Rexroth's response was textbook:
- System-wide ESD protectionFrom the belt material to the roller bearing, the surface resistance is stable at 10⁶-10⁹Ω, and the static electricity is not discharged.
- Humidity fluctuation compensation: Stainless steel bearings carry 1% RH rust, ceramic-coated rollers thoroughly insulated
- Energy assassin turned energy-saving king: Conventional drying line energy consumption 7.5 kW/h, modular programme down to 5.2 kW/h -Enough electricity to run three milk tea shops.(based on 24-hour operation)
